I'm Mahmoud Fayyaz — known in the Amsterdam dance community as Phiiaz. I've spent over 11 years immersed in African-influenced partner dances.

My focus is on three deeply connected dance styles: Kizomba, Urbankiz, and Tarraxo. Each has its own language — Kizomba's grounded connection, Urbankiz's contemporary flair, and Tarraxo's slow, meditative groove — and I love helping students discover what resonates with them personally.

My teaching philosophy is simple: I am a nerd when it comes to the details, In my prevous life as a software engineer I learned the importance of clean code and efficient algorithms, and I bring that same mindset to my dance teaching. I believe in breaking down complex movements into simple, understandable steps, and helping students build a strong foundation that they can use to develop their own unique style.

I run regular classes as Tarraxo Toolbox, intensives, and the Tarraxo Movement lab workshop series at Haven Amsterdam — one of the city's most vibrant cultural venues. My events bring together dancers of all levels in a warm, inclusive atmosphere where curiosity is always welcome.

The Tuesday evening program is changing. As of July, it runs as two classes back-to-back — with social dancing between them. Same evening. Same studio. Two different ways in. TARRAXO TOOLBOX Ā· 19:00–20:15 The concept class. July theme: The Conversation. Tarraxo is a dialogue between two bodies. This month we go into the mechanics of that dialogue — what it means to offer something and receive it, what listening actually feels like in the body, how to create space and fill it, and why the pause is not the gap between movements but the movement itself. Four Tuesdays, four ideas. Each class builds on the last. Jul 7 — Offer & Receive Ā· Jul 14 — Listening Ā· Jul 21 — Call & Response Ā· Jul 28 — Silence Intermediate level. Some Tarraxo or Kizomba experience assumed. —— LA PAUSA Ā· 20:15–20:45 30 minutes of free social dancing between the two classes. If you did Toolbox, this is where you try what you just worked on. If you're arriving for Practical, this is your warm-up. —— PRACTICAL TARRAXO Ā· 20:45–22:00 The social floor class. July theme: No Saida. The figure, its variations, how to chain them, and how to make them feel like a choice instead of a sequence you're trying to remember. Tarraxo or Kizomba background helpful. In Tarraxo, what you move matters less than how you move it. This month we work on the controls — the qualities that change what a move says without changing the move itself. Four weeks, four dials: Week 1 — Medium of Motion: The same step feels completely different depending on whether you're moving through air, water, or honey. We start here. Week 2 — Magnitude: How big or small is your movement? Most dancers have one default. This week we find it and learn to leave it. Week 3 — Flow: Staccato or legato — punctuated or continuous. The difference between a dance that has tension and one that just keeps going. Week 4 — Tempo: You've worked with this one before. This week it joins the other three and we play the full panel.
